Zulu Nyala, South Africa
This gallery contains scenery and wildlife at Zulu Nyala Lodge and Game Reserve in South Africa.
Zulu Nyala is located on the rolling hills of Zululand on the Eastern Cape, situated southeast of Swaziland about 150 kilometers inland from the coast of the Indian Ocean. (GPS: -27.90078, 32.2723) They have a couple of luxury lodges and a tented safari camp, but don't let the term, "tented", give you the wrong idea. These are really permanent structures; luxury huts with canvas roofs.
The ranger guides have a lot of experience tracking the animals and we had plenty of opportunities to get up-close and personal with the animals, as you can probably see from these photos. The game drives seem to cater to photographers since they try to schedule the drives around sunrise and sunset during the "golden hours". Since the light at these times isn't always sufficient for many point and shoot cameras and even some SLRs with kit lenses, capturing photos of wildlife could be challenging. I used a Nikon 70-200mm f/2.8 zoom with vibration reduction for most of the animal shots.
